Retail Analytics Software Overview

Retail analytics software is an important tool that businesses in the retail industry use to better understand how their products and services are selling. It allows them to gain insights into customer behavior, patterns, trends, and sales performance. With this data, they can make more informed decisions about their products and services, as well as improve the customer experience.

The software works by collecting data from a variety of sources including point-of sale (POS) systems, inventory tracking systems, customer feedback surveys, online purchase histories, web analytics tools, and more. This data is then aggregated and analyzed to provide reports on various areas such as sales figures, average transaction values (ATV), average sale value (ASV), market share analysis, stock movement analysis, product popularity analysis, customer segmentation analysis, promotions effectiveness analysis and more. All these reports allow retailers to see where their business stands in comparison with competitors or particular segments within their industry.

Analytics software also offers predictive analytics capabilities which enable retailers to forecast future performance by looking at past data points such as seasonality or pricing structure changes. Additionally, it can be used for marketing purposes such as personalizing offers for customers based on demographic data or running A/B testing of campaigns to analyze effectiveness.

Overall retail analytics software provides an easy way for retailers to get actionable insights into their businesses ā€“ allowing them to make smarter decisions with greater confidence while improving customer satisfaction levels at the same time.

How Much Does Retail Analytics Software Cost?

The cost of retail analytics software depends on the type of functionality and features you require. Generally, there are three types of pricing models: subscription-based, one-time purchase or pay as you go.

Subscription-based software typically offers a monthly fee that includes access to all features with no additional fees for installation, data storage and other services. This option is popular among small businesses since it provides an easy way to manage expenses without making a large upfront payment. However, if your business needs change or expand over time, you may need to upgrade your subscription or start paying extra fees for new features or increased levels of support.

Purchasing retail analytics software outright can be expensive but may offer a lower cost in the long run compared to monthly subscriptions and ongoing fees. If you choose this route, calculate how long it will take for the upfront costs to be offset by the savings generated by using the software before making a decision. Also consider any necessary hardware upgrades that would be required in order to use the system effectively and efficiently.

Pay as you go options provide access to basic features while allowing users to tailor their package according to their needs by adding additional modules and services when needed like customer segmentation or predictive analytics capabilities at an additional cost per module/service used. This type of model is ideal for businesses that don't have large budgets but need quick access and scalability as their business grows over time.

As each businessā€™s needs are unique, prices vary widely depending on what specific features are required from the platform along with other factors such as customer service level needed, duration of contract signed etc., so it's best speak with someone from the provider directly in order get a more accurate estimate based on your particular requirements.

Risks Associated With Retail Analytics Software

  • Security Risk: Retail analytics software often stores sensitive customer data, such as credit card numbers, shipping addresses and product purchases. This information can be vulnerable to malicious attackers if the software or system is not properly secured.
  • Compliance Risk: Retail analytics software must adhere to local regulations and privacy laws. If the software is not properly configured to meet all applicable requirements, it could result in hefty fines or other penalties imposed by regulators.
  • Cost Risk: Poorly chosen retail analytics software can result in unnecessary costs due to features that are not used or outdated technology that requires frequent updates and maintenance.
  • Privacy Risk: Gathering and storing too much customer data for analysis can create potential privacy issues for customers. Inadequate measures can lead to unauthorized access of customersā€™ personal information which could negatively impact reputation of a company.
  • Data Quality Risk: Poor quality of inputted data into the system or incorrect analysis conducted on the data may lead to inaccurate reports or conclusions being made based on these flawed results which could have an adverse effect on decision making ability within a retail organization.
